Man Wanted For Shoplifting And Assaulting A Shop Worker In Chichester

Police are hoping to identify a man in relation to a theft and assault in Chichester.

 

The suspect entered Co-op in Stockbridge Road on Sunday, July 9 and filled his basket full of items before leaving without paying.

He returned a short while later, attempted to steal further items and assaulted a member of staff when he tried to leave the store.

Police believe the man in this image may be able to help with their enquiries.

He is described as a white man, approximately 25 years old with light coloured short hair.

At the time of the offence, he was wearing a black t-shirt and black shorts. He was also wearing black and white Adidas sliders.

Witnesses or anyone with information which could help should come forward by reporting online or calling 101 and quoting serial 1273 of 09/07.
